Zayn and Jisoo take love to the stars in their new single “Eyes Closed,” a dreamy duet released Friday alongside an intergalactic music video. The collaboration marks the first time the Blackpink superstar and former One Direction member have joined forces — and the result feels both ethereal and intimate.
A Celestial Love Story
In the cinematic visual, the two singers float through a sleek spaceship, orbiting through cosmic landscapes before finally finding each other mid-galaxy. As they meet, their voices blend seamlessly on the chorus:
“Said, oh, we should fall in love with our eyes closed / Better if we keep it where we don’t know.”
The lyrics capture the song’s central theme — surrendering to love without judgment or fear.
Building Anticipation
Both artists had been teasing “Eyes Closed” for weeks, sharing short clips and lyrics on social media. The track’s release arrives at a pivotal moment for both stars. Zayn is preparing for his Las Vegas residency in mid-January, and just last week, he announced plans to reunite with former bandmate Louis Tomlinson for an upcoming Netflix series.
Meanwhile, Jisoo’s fans have eagerly awaited her next project. “Eyes Closed” marks her first release since her acclaimed solo EP, Amortage, which featured standout tracks like “Earthquake,” “Hugs & Kisses,” and “Your Love.” She is currently on tour with Blackpink, with shows scheduled through late January 2026.
A Rare Collaboration
Zayn is known for keeping his collaborations selective, which makes this duet even more special. His past partnerships include Taylor Swift on Fifty Shades Darker’s “I Don’t Wanna Live Forever,” Sia on “Dusk Till Dawn,” and SHAED on “Trampoline.”
